Output 8008338a81df1e9b3a897930e7732840647a828631b6c8328f08b9566d993852:22

value
2453622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ef4bb7603a5089618c72217d1d910f0821b1e55 OP_EQUAL
address
37RtzjVWiSjgJxNnyiEQhMMxaJGLT6E7Z6
transaction
8008338a81df1e9b3a897930e7732840647a828631b6c8328f08b9566d993852
spent
true